  • Somatic Attachment Therapy (DARe) helps change the relationship patterns your nervous system learned long ago.

    Many of us learned survival strategies in relationships like people pleasing, shutting down, overthinking, fear of abandonment, or struggling with intimacy. While these patterns once helped protect us, they can create painful cycles in adult relationships.

    DARe combines attachment science, nervous system healing, and somatic work to help you feel safer in love, more connected to yourself, and more secure in relationships.

    Many of us spend years stuck in survival mode — overthinking, people pleasing, shutting down, staying anxious, bracing for the worst, or feeling disconnected from ourselves and others. Even when life looks “fine” on the outside, the body can still feel unsafe underneath.

    Somatic Experiencing works by gently helping you reconnect with your body and nervous system instead of only trying to “think” your way through healing.

    Because healing isn’t just mental.
    Your body holds stress, heartbreak, fear, overwhelm, and old survival patterns too.
